Kentucky Hunting Seasons
Whitetail Deer
Res: $27 Non-res: $195
| Season Type | Opens | Closes |
|---|---|---|
| Archery | Sep 2 | Jan 20 |
| Muzzleloader | Oct 21 | Oct 22 |
| Rifle | Nov 11 | Nov 26 |
Bag limits: daily: 1, season: 4 (1 antlered)
One antlered deer and additional antlerless deer with bonus permits. Kentucky has excellent trophy deer potential.
Turkey
Res: $27 Non-res: $195
| Season Type | Opens | Closes |
|---|---|---|
| Shotgun | Apr 15 | May 7 |
| Archery | Apr 15 | May 7 |
Bag limits: daily: 1, season: 2 (spring)
Spring gobblers with visible beards. Youth weekend before regular season. Fall season in limited zones.
Elk
Res: $30 Non-res: $400
| Season Type | Opens | Closes |
|---|---|---|
| Rifle | Sep 16 | Sep 25 |
| Archery | Sep 9 | Sep 15 |
Bag limits: daily: 1, season: 1
Limited to 16 southeastern counties. Lottery draw with very limited permits. One of the best eastern elk herds in the US.

Do I need a hunting license in Kentucky?
Yes. All hunters in Kentucky must hold a valid hunting license from the Kentucky Department of Fish & Wildlife Resources. Non-residents typically pay higher fees. A hunter safety course is required for first-time license buyers.

Does Kentucky require a hunter safety course?
Yes, Kentucky requires hunter education certification for all first-time hunters. The course covers firearm safety, hunting laws, wildlife conservation, and ethical hunting practices.
Who manages hunting regulations in Kentucky?
The Kentucky Department of Fish & Wildlife Resources manages all hunting licenses, regulations, and wildlife management in Kentucky. Their website (https://fw.ky.gov) has current season dates, license purchasing, and regulation booklets.
